Arverne East Supports Rockaway Sports Association

Pictured, front row, (L to R); Captains Zachery Lopez and Brandon Pena, Kaseem Holloway, Kahsim Teaque, Najee Odem, Corey Lopez, Taj Peterson, Hardy Ceballos and Keith Watson. Kneeling- Donnell Harris and team co-captain Lamar Holloway.
The Rockaway Sports Association, (RSA) wishes to thank Arverne East, and a special thanks to Susan Fine (Project Manager - Arverne East), for their support in the RSA's efforts to attend the 2008 Friendship Games in Las Vegas and the World Youth Games in Vancouver, British Columbia.

Arverne East has supported the RSA from its beginnings and would like to continue to build a relationship that will support the Rockaway Sports community youth lacrosse program.

Rockaway Sports Association Head Coach Greg Carter is glad for Arverne East's contribution.

"It is always important for corporations as Arverne East, especially when they are a major developer in the reconstruction of the Rockaways, to show the youth in our community that they will assist in any and all efforts to enhance our youths' educational lives through the sport of lacrosse."
